#d53b09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d53b09 is composed of 83.5% red, 23.1%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 14.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 43.5%. #d53b09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7612 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d53b09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d53b09 has RGB values of R:213, G:59,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.96,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13974281.

Shades and Tints of #d53b09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060200 is the darkest color, while #fef5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d53b09
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776b67 is the less saturated color, while #de3700 is the most saturated one.
